Adobe's Initiative to Boost Digital Literacy in India
Adobe has announced a significant initiative that aims to enhance digital literacy and creative skills among students in India. The company is providing free access to some of its most popular software tools, including Photoshop, Acrobat, and Firefly AI.
Key Software Tools Available
- Photoshop: A leading image editing software widely used across various industries.
- Acrobat: A tool for creating, editing, and managing PDF documents, essential for both educational and professional environments.
- Firefly AI: Adobe's AI tool designed to assist in creative processes, highlighting its increasing role in educational contexts.
